#963663 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#963663 is composed of 58.8% red, 21.2%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64% magenta, 34%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 331.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.1% and a lightness of 40%. #963663 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cc6 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#963663 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#963663 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#963663 has RGB values of R:150, G:54,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.34,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9844323.

Shades and Tints of #963663

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060204 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#963663

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676566 is the less saturated color, while #c50760 is the most saturated one.
